Pyrazinamide-d3 usage and description
Pyrazinamide D3 is an isotopically labeled form of Pyrazinamide, a drug used to treat tuberculosis. Pyrazinamide D3 is used in research studies to investigate the pharmacokinetics and metabolism of Pyrazinamide in the body.
Pyrazinamide works by inhibiting the growth of Mycobacterium tuberculosis, the bacteria that cause tuberculosis. It is often used in combination with other drugs to treat active tuberculosis infections and to prevent the development of drug-resistant strains of the bacteria.
Chemically, Pyrazinamide is a pyrazine carboxamide derivative with the molecular formula C5H5N3O. Pyrazinamide D3 has the same chemical structure as Pyrazinamide, but with three deuterium atoms substituted for three hydrogen atoms. This isotopic labeling allows researchers to track the drug's distribution and metabolism in the body using mass spectrometry.
